New Delhi: Prime Minister Narendra Modi will address the nation on 'Mann Ki Baat' programme at 11am today.
In this monthly radio programme, the Prime Minister shares his thoughts with the nation.
This will be the 22nd edition of the PM Modi's radio programme. The first edition of the programme was aired on October 3, 2014.
The programme has been initiated with an aim to reach out to people in remote corners of the country.
The Prime Minister had urged the people to share their ideas for the programme on the MyGov Open Forum.
As usual the programme will be broadcast by All India Radio and Doordarshan.
